AAL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review

653 of the 3,812 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in American Airlines Group (AAL)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$18.5B — up 5.1% from $17.6B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 97 funds opened new AAL positions and 69 closed out — a net gain of 28 holders — while 172 added to existing stakes and 293 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Primecap Management, adding an estimated $140M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$271M.
